Domaine Duemani
Duemani is owned by Luca d'Atoma and his wife Elena. A man of passion, he is one of the giants of Italian oenology, alongside Angelo Gaja and Elio Altare. Acclaimed by the world press, he is the consulting oenologist for legendary estates such as Tua Rita (the first estate to obtain a 100/100 Parker rating in Italy), Le Machiole (Bolgheri), etc. In 2000, the Atomas decided to start producing their own wine. They bought 8 hectares on one of the best Tuscan terroirs, around Riparbella, southeast of Florence, and around Bolgheri, to make one of the greatest Italian wines: Duemani (meaning "two hands").
They planted three grape varieties: Cabernet Franc, Syrah, and Merlot, producing a total of just 40,000 bottles. The soil structure is extraordinary, with a predominance of clay and stones. The low fertility of this soil gives the Duemani wines a more pronounced character and complexity. The estate's unique location, at an altitude of 200 meters in a west-facing amphitheater facing the Etruscan coast, provides perfect ventilation, allowing for the eradication of all chemicals and ensuring a very high quality of grapes for the wine. The vines are cultivated biodynamically, without the use of any chemicals in the vineyard or in the cellars, where Luca uses only indigenous yeasts. For vinification, he uses concrete vats and wooden vats to preserve the delicacy of the grapes.
In just 10 years, Luca and Elena have taken their estate to the highest heights. Their wines are acclaimed by the international press and receive top ratings every year from global critics such as Parker, Stephan Tanzer, James Suckling, and others.
